Position Overview

Clerical Officer – Branch: South Metropolitan Education Region – Location: Beaconsfield – Salary: Level 1, $65,728 – $74,951 per annum (pro‑rate) – Full Time – Permanent – Closing Date: 6 January 2026.

The Role

The Clerical Officer provides general administrative support, including undertaking basic research and preparing correspondence, notices and other materials. The officer undertakes reception duties, greeting visitors, answering the telephone and responding to routine enquiries and requests for information.

If successful, the officer operates and maintains office equipment, monitors and orders office consumables, and assists with travel arrangements, including booking flights and accommodation.

Professional Benefits
  • 12% employer contributed superannuation.
  • Flexible working arrangements to create a healthy work life balance, including working from home or remote, flexible working hours and part-time arrangements.
  • Generous leave entitlements including annual, personal, long service and parental leave.
  • Professional development opportunities and study leave assistance.
  • Access to salary packaging (in accordance with relevant industrial instruments).
Qualifications and Eligibility
  • Be an Australian or New Zealand citizen, permanent resident or hold a valid visa with relevant work rights for the term of the appointment.
  • Consent to obtain a current Screening Clearance Number issued by the Department of Education’s Screening Unit before you start.
  • Obtain or hold a current Working with Children Check.
